APPLICATION FOR FOREIGN TRADE ZONE ADMISSION
Merchandise may be admitted into a zone only upon application on a uniquely and sequentially numbered Customs Form 214 and the issuance of a permit by the port director at a U.S Customs port of entry. A partial list of benefits includes: No duty is ever paid on re-exported merchandise; if the merchandise is sold domestically, no duty is paid until it leaves the zone or zones; no duty is paid on waste; duty on scrap is eliminated or reduced; generally, if foreign merchandise is manufactured into a product with a lower duty rate, the lower duty rate applies on the foreign content when duty is paid; merchandise in a zone may be stored, repackaged, manipulated, manufactured, destroyed or otherwise altered or changed.
